How they compare

Azerbaijan currently reports 9.38 kg/ha against 8.76 kg/ha in Zimbabwe, a difference of 0.62 kg/ha.

That makes Azerbaijan's figure about 1.1 times Zimbabwe's.

The two have swapped places 7 times across 32 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Zimbabwe ahead.

Azerbaijan ranks 161st and Zimbabwe ranks 163rd of 201 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Azerbaijan averaged higher in 3 and Zimbabwe in 1.

The Cropland Nutrient balance domain contains information on the flows of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ium from mineral fertilizer, manure applied, atmospheric deposition, crop removal, and biological fixation over cropland and per unit area of cropland. The flows are aggregated to total inputs and total outputs, from which the overall nutrient balance and nutrient use efficiency on cropland are calculated. Statistics are disseminated in units of tonnes and in kg/ha, as appropriate. Nutrient use efficiency is expressed as a fraction (%).
